Arafat Day occurs on the 9th day of Dhul Hijja, just about 70 days after the end of Ramadan. Saudi Government has selected only 10,000 Muslim males and females. This pilgrimage is a mandatory religious duty for Muslims that must be carried out at least once in their lifetime by all who are physically and financially capable of undertaking the journey. The Day of Arafah (Arabic: يوم عرفة , romanized: Yawm ‘Arafah) is an Islamic holiday that falls on the 9th day of Dhu al-Hijjah of the lunar Islamic Calendar.
